14 Facts About Fula people

1.

Fula, Fellah, Fellahin, Fulani, or Ful?e people are one of the largest ethnic groups in the Sahel and West Africa, widely dispersed across the region.

The fairly rigid caste system of the Fula people has medieval roots, was well established by the 15th-century, and it has survived into modern age.

FactSnippet No. 1,133,897
10.

The castes-based social stratification among the Fula people was widespread and seen across the Sahel, such as Burkina Faso, Niger, Senegal, Guinea, Mali, Nigeria, Sudan, and others.
